TIWN June 8, 2016
AGARTALA, June 8 (TIWN): Although IPFT took a break from their demand of Twipra land, but once again they have come up with their earlier demand for a separate land along with some more demands.
IPFT held a press meet on Wednesday to announce that party is going to observe strike and to stop railway and national highway for 24 hours in demand of Twipra land.
Along with the strike announcement, IPFT also demanded about 79 persons’ joining in IPFT at Tatia Para, under Gandachara RD Block.
Addressing the press meet Vice-president of IPFT Ananta Debbarma said that the ADC areas are to convert into a separate Twipra Land and IPFT was demanding for a separate land since 2009.
‘IPFT has expanded their protests outside the state, including Delhi’, said Debbarma.
To enlarge the protest, IPFT will halt railway service and block National Highway on June 22.
Slamming the ruling Govt. party vice-president said that the Trible Welfare Dept.’s reports are different from ADC original reports, which is a major reason behind the lack of development of ADC areas.
He also added, “On 18th February, 2016 central govt. had allocated Rs. 175.95 crores for ADC development. That fund was ordered to utilize in the development of ADC, but till day no fund has been transferred to ADC.
Protesting all these IPFT is going for a massive protest and announced that all kinds of vehicle strikes including railway service will be stopped on June 22.
